Автоматическая дверь курятника: 5 шагов (с изображениями)
Автоматическая дверь курятника: 5 шагов (с изображениями)
Anonim
Image
Image

Автоматические двери в курятниках - это спасение от ночных хищников, таких как еноты, опоссумы и дикие кошки! Однако типичная автоматическая дверь стоит более 200 долларов на Amazon (Автоматическая дверь курятника) и непомерно дорога для многих мелких владельцев кур. Для создания этого проекта необходим некоторый опыт работы с Arduino. Ознакомьтесь с этими руководствами по Arduino, если вы никогда не работали с Arduino. Это руководство было создано параллельно с руководствами, приведенными ниже, для создания автоматизированного, переработанного курятника. Таким образом, предполагается, что ваш курятник будет иметь аналогичную планировку, а также источник питания 12 В / солнечные панели, способные выдавать до 10 ампер.

Наконец, мы не несем ответственности за какой-либо вред / травмы, нанесенные вам в этом опасном руководстве по самостоятельному строительству!

Шаг 1. Инструменты, которые вам понадобятся

Инструменты, которые вам понадобятся
Инструменты, которые вам понадобятся
Инструменты, которые вам понадобятся
Инструменты, которые вам понадобятся
Инструменты, которые вам понадобятся
Инструменты, которые вам понадобятся

Паяльник

Маленькая крестовая отвертка

Инструмент для зачистки проводов

Сверла и сверла

Шаг 2: выбор материалов

Выбор материалов
Выбор материалов
Выбор материалов
Выбор материалов
Выбор материалов
Выбор материалов

Большинство материалов в этом руководстве может быть получено из различных потоков отходов, однако вот некоторые компоненты, которые вам, вероятно, придется приобрести.

Купленные материалы:

  • Arduino Mega за 15 долларов
  • Высокоточный таймер за $ 7
  • Н-мост L298 за $ 7
  • Однополюсные двухходовые реле за $ 11

Примечание: если вы можете вытащить реле из автомобиля, вам нужно всего 2

  • Перемычки за 7 долларов для Arduino
  • Выключатели мгновенного действия за $ 9

Остальные материалы мы получили, отправившись на наш местный склад или на свалку. Если у вас нет времени или возможности найти материалы, вы можете приобрести их в Интернете.

Переработанные материалы:

$ 30 12В автомобильный стеклоподъемник с жгутом проводов

Мы нашли наш в местном магазине Pick n'pull. Быстрый поиск в Google поможет найти ближайшие к вам места. Также на Youtube есть видео по разборке автомобильных дверей на большинстве моделей!

$ 12 проволочные гайки

Вы можете утилизировать их из того же автомобиля (см. Выше).

11 $ 22-дюймовые направляющие для ящиков

Их можно вытащить из старого комода

7,35 $ Фанерный лист 12 дюймов x 12 дюймов

Эта фанера будет выполнять роль двери. Подойдет любая квадратная доска или металлический лист!

  • Изолента за 4 доллара
  • $ 10 14AWG Красный и черный провод

Шаг 3: Построение схемы

Конструкция схемы
Конструкция схемы
Конструкция схемы
Конструкция схемы
Конструкция схемы
Конструкция схемы

Легче подключить узлы 5 В, 12 В и заземление на рисунке с помощью гайки из шага 2. Вот полезное видео о том, как правильно использовать гайки.

На первом рисунке подключения 12 В могут поступать либо от аккумулятора мотоцикла / автомобиля 12 В, либо от другого источника питания 12 В. Какой бы источник питания вы ни решили использовать, убедитесь, что он способен выдавать до 10 А, поскольку пусковой ток для индуктивного двигателя может быть довольно большим. Также может быть полезно установить плавкий предохранитель на 10 А в соответствии с источником питания, чтобы защитить остальную электронику от потенциального короткого замыкания.

Паяные переключатели мгновенного действия

Следующий шаг требует пайки. Вот полезное видео по пайке переключателя. Поскольку переключатели мгновенного действия будут размещены в верхней и нижней части хода двери, убедитесь, что вы перерезали достаточно провода, чтобы пройти из этого положения туда, где ваш Arduino будет в курятнике. Припаяйте один провод к нормально разомкнутой (NO) клемме и оберните его изолентой или термоусадочной пленкой (другой конец будет прикреплен к источнику 5 В). Припаяйте еще один провод к общему выводу (C) и также обмотайте его изолентой. Процедура для верхнего и нижнего переключателей одинакова, однако общий штифт на кнопочном переключателе в верхней части двери подключается к A8 на Arduino, тогда как общий контакт на нижнем защелкивающемся переключателе прикрепляется к A14 на Arduino (см. Схему подключения).

Подключение часов и H-моста L-298

Используйте провода «папа» / «мама» для подключения часов и h-моста к Arduino (см. Схему подключения).

Подключение реле

Реле из шага 2 поставляются с жгутом проводов, который можно надеть на контакты реле. Если вы используете другое однополюсное реле на два хода, третий рисунок выше может быть вам полезен.

Подключите клеммы 85 и 86 реле к выходным контактам H-моста L298, ввинтив их в плату (полярность не имеет значения).

Подсоедините центральный штифт (87A) к узлу заземления (гайку провода).

Подключите контакт 87 к узлу +12 В.

Наконец, убедитесь, что все оголенные провода изолированы изолентой вокруг всех незакрепленных соединений!

Шаг 4: загрузка кода в Arduino

Загрузка кода в Arduino
Загрузка кода в Arduino
Загрузка кода в Arduino
Загрузка кода в Arduino
Загрузка кода в Arduino
Загрузка кода в Arduino

Скачать Arduino Ide

Сначала загрузите Arduino IDE для своей операционной системы здесь: Arduino IDE

Скачать код Arduino

Автоматическая дверь курятника с соленоидом

Соленоид - дополнительное приспособление в этом проекте. Чтобы увидеть, как устроена цепь соленоида, посетите нашу инструкцию по автоматическому запотеванию!

Импортировать библиотеки

Для этого проекта вам нужно будет импортировать 4 библиотеки.

Timelord, DS3231, OneWire и DallasTemperature

Вот полезное видео по установке библиотеки, если она вам понадобится.

Изменение кода

Единственные разделы кода, которые вам нужно изменить, выделены на приведенных рисунках.

Первый раздел - это широта и долгота. Обновите их, чтобы они соответствовали географическому положению вашего курятника (вы можете найти их, наведя курсор на точку на картах Google).

Затем обновите часовой пояс, чтобы он соответствовал вашему собственному. Вот полезная ссылка для определения вашего часового пояса в формате UTC.

Наконец, обновите строки setTime и setDate в коде Arduino.

т.е. rtc.setTime (час, минута, секунда)

rtc.setDate (день, месяц, год)

Шаг 5: Установка оборудования

Установка оборудования
Установка оборудования
Установка оборудования
Установка оборудования
Установка оборудования
Установка оборудования

1. Просверлите отверстие в верхней части двери курятника и прикрепите шнур.

убедитесь, что он ровный, повесив веревку. Если он слишком сильно наклонен в любом направлении, проделайте новое отверстие ближе к той стороне, которая висит ниже.

2. Установите дверцу курятника с направляющими.

3. Установите двигатель над дверью на одной линии с веревкой (убедитесь, что у вас достаточно свободного места для полного открытия дверцы.

4. Установите переключатели мгновенного действия вверху и внизу двери.

Мы просверлили два отверстия, совместимых с отверстиями на переключателях, и закрепили их стяжками.

Сдвиньте дверь вверх и вниз по направляющей и убедитесь, что переключатели нажаты. В противном случае вам может потребоваться добавить какую-то прокладку. Мы просверлили несколько отверстий в пластике, который лежал вокруг, и продеваем через них стяжки.

4. Создайте полку для электроники.

Убедитесь, что это вне досягаемости цыплят

5. Поместите всю электронику в водонепроницаемый контейнер (мы использовали прозрачный контейнер Tupperware и просверлили сбоку отверстие для проводов).

6. Убедитесь, что ваша электроника защищена от ударов. Мы добились этого, добавив шарнирную коробку вокруг батареи и установив барьеры перед переключателями мгновенного действия, чтобы их было труднее клевать.

Рекомендуемые: